是的,服务器带宽只有 1Mbps(也就是你说的“1M”)确实会非常慢,特别是在现代网络环境中。下面我来详细解释一下原因,并提供一些优化建议。
🌐 一、1M 带宽到底有多慢?
换算关系:
- 1 Mbps = 128 KB/s(不是 MB,是 KB)
也就是说,理论最大下载速度是 每秒 128KB,实际使用中还可能因为网络损耗、服务器性能、并发访问等因素更低。
实际体验举例:
| 文件大小 | 理论下载时间 |
|---|---|
| 1MB | ~8 秒 |
| 10MB | ~1 分 20 秒 |
| 100MB | ~13 分钟 |
| 网页页面(含图片) | 几秒到几十秒 |
🧪 二、为什么你会觉得特别慢?
-
网页加载慢
- 现代网页平均大小在 2~4MB 左右,1M 带宽加载一个网页就可能要几秒甚至十几秒。
- 如果页面有多个资源文件(JS、CSS、图片),加载时间成倍增加。
-
多人访问时更卡
- 1M 带宽是共享的,如果有多个用户同时访问你的网站或服务,每个人分到的速度就会更小,导致排队和延迟。
-
上传/下载大文件几乎不可用
- 上传一张高清图片都要几秒钟,下载个软件包可能要等几分钟甚至更久。
🔧 三、解决办法 & 优化建议
✅ 1. 升级带宽
这是最直接有效的办法:
- 找云服务商(如阿里云、腾讯云、华为云等)升级带宽配置。
- 成本不高:比如从 1M 升到 5M 或 10M,每月可能只多花几十元。
✅ 2. 使用 CDN
- 将静态资源(图片、CSS、JS)托管到 CDN 上,减轻服务器压力。
- 推荐:Cloudflare(免费)、七牛云、又拍云、阿里云 CDN。
✅ 3. 压缩与缓存优化
- 启用 Gzip 或 Brotli 压缩,减小传输体积。
- 设置浏览器缓存策略,减少重复请求。
✅ 4. 图片优化
- 使用 WebP 格式替代 JPEG/PNG。
- 图片压缩工具(TinyPNG、Squoosh)处理后再上传。
✅ 5. 避免大文件直传
- 不要在服务器上直接提供大文件下载。
- 改为使用对象存储(OSS、S3) + CDN 的方式。
💡 四、什么时候适合用 1M 带宽?
1M 带宽其实只适合以下几种场景:
- 纯文本 API 接口服务
- 低频访问的后台管理系统
- 学习用途的小型博客(无图或极少图)
- 内网服务或者调试环境
📌 总结
| 问题 | 原因 | 解决方案 |
|---|---|---|
| 服务器访问慢 | 带宽太小(1Mbps) | 升级带宽、使用 CDN、优化内容 |
| 多人访问卡顿 | 带宽共享瓶颈 | 提升并发能力、负载均衡 |
| 下载速度慢 | 传输速率限制 | 压缩数据、使用对象存储 |
如果你告诉我你具体运行的是什么服务(网站?API?视频?下载?),我可以给出更有针对性的优化建议 😊
需要帮你看看怎么升级带宽或配置 CDN 吗?
云计算HECS